Solution

The correct option is A

Anuria


The failure of the kidneys to produce urine is anuria.

Ketonuria is the excretion of abnormally large amounts of ketone bodies in the urine, characteristic of diabetes mellitus, starvation, or other medical conditions.

Hematuria is the presence of red blood cells in the urine.

The presence of creatine in urine is creatinuria.
